#f59fc1 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#f59fc1 is composed of 96.1% red, 62.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 336.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 79.2%. #f59fc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b3f83.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f59fc1 color description : Very soft pink.

The hexadecimal color #f59fc1 has RGB values of R:245, G:159,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.21,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16097217.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0105 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ccc8ca is the less saturated color, while #fd97bf is the most saturated one.
